These cords, in fabric made from Milan's premier mill, have a luxurious feel, not unlike velvet. Vellutto Duca Visconti di Modrone is one of the few mills that hand-cuts the pile.
8 Wale Cord Pant (No. 2811) in velvety cotton. Other significant details: Double front pleat.
On-seam front pockets, two double-welt back pockets with buttons. Six
interior suspender buttons. Eight belt loops. Interior French-fly closure.
